The Role of a Car Locksmith
A car locksmith specializes in offering security services for lorries, including key replacement, lock setup, and emergency situation lockout assistance. Unlike a basic locksmith who deals with a range of locks, an automotive locksmith focuses entirely on the intricate mechanisms discovered in cars and trucks, trucks, and other vehicles. These experts are geared up with the newest tools and innovation to deal with a wide variety of automotive security needs.
Common Services Offered by Car Locksmiths
Key Replacement and Duplication
Lost or Stolen Keys: If you've misplaced your keys or they have been stolen, a car locksmith can supply a new set. They utilize specific devices to develop precise duplicates of your initial keys.Broken Keys: Sometimes, keys break inside the lock, making it difficult to eliminate them. A professional locksmith can extract the broken key and produce a new one.
Keyless Entry and Ignition Systems
Programing Key Fobs: Modern automobiles often come with keyless entry systems. A car locksmith can program and replace key fobs, guaranteeing that your vehicle's electronic components function perfectly.Ignition Interlock Devices: For chauffeurs with a history of DUI, ignition interlock gadgets are in some cases mandated by law. A car locksmith can set up and keep these gadgets.
Lock Installation and Repair
New Locks: If your vehicle's locks are harmed or malfunctioning, a car locksmith can set up new ones.Lock Repair: Rather than replacing locks, a locksmith can often repair them, saving you money and time.
Emergency Situation Lockout Assistance
24/7 Service: Being locked out of your car can take place at any time. Numerous car locksmiths use 24/7 emergency situation services to help you get back on the roadway rapidly.Professional Tools: They use specialized tools to unlock your vehicle without triggering damage, which is particularly crucial for newer designs with intricate security systems.
High-Security Locks and Keys
Transponder Keys: These keys consist of a chip that communicates with the car's computer system. A car locksmith can program and replace these keys.Laser-Cut Keys: Some high-end cars utilize laser-cut keys for enhanced security. Q: How do I know if a car locksmith is genuine?
A: A legitimate car locksmith will be licensed, bonded, and guaranteed. They ought to likewise be able to offer proof of ownership before carrying out any services. Additionally, check for favorable evaluations and a great track record in the neighborhood.
Q: Can a car locksmith make a key for a vehicle without the original?
A: Yes, an expert car locksmith can develop a brand-new key even if you do not have the original. Nevertheless, they will need the vehicle's make, model, and often the VIN to make sure the key is correct.
Q: How long does it take to replace a car key?
A: The time it requires to replace a car locksmith cheap near me key can differ depending upon the complexity of the lock and the type of key. Easy key duplications can take just a couple of minutes, while more complicated jobs like programming transponder keys may take an hour or more.
Q: Will a car locksmith damage my vehicle when opening it?
A: A professional car locksmith will utilize non-invasive strategies to open your vehicle, minimizing the risk of damage. Nevertheless, if a key is stuck in the lock, some minor damage may be inescapable.
Q: Can a car locksmith bypass the ignition system?
A: While a competent Cheapest car locksmith near me locksmith can bypass the ignition system to open your car, they will refrain from doing so unless you can show ownership of the vehicle. Bypassing the ignition system without proper permission is illegal.
